House of Representatives Announces the Passing of Honourable Ekene Abubakar Adams

Date:

Nigeria’s House of Representatives has sorrowfully announced the passing of Honourable Ekene Abubakar Adams, a member of the 10th Assembly representing Kaduna State.

The Chairman of the House Committee on Media and Public Affairs, Honourable Akin Rotimi Junior, shared the news of Honourable Adams’ demise on Tuesday.

Honourable Adams, who was 39 years old, passed away early Tuesday. Until his untimely death, he served as the chairman of the House Committee on Sports.

Representing the Chikun/Kajuru Federal Constituency of Kaduna State, Honourable Adams was in his first term as a member of the House of Representatives.

In a statement, he was described as a dedicated public servant, a passionate sports administrator, and a generous philanthropist.

The House of Representatives acknowledged his unwavering commitment to the development of grassroots sports in Nigeria and expressed deep sorrow over his passing, noting that his contributions to the House will be greatly missed.

The House extended heartfelt condolences to Honourable Adams’ family, friends, constituents, and the people and Government of Kaduna State. They prayed for strength and comfort for his family and loved ones during this difficult time.
